Connect to Hugging Face from wizards and query Hugging Face data from the GUI in the RazorSQL database management tool.

The CData JDBC Driver for Hugging Face enables standards-based access from third-party tools, from wizards in IDEs to data management and analysis tools. This article shows how to connect to Hugging Face using wizards in RazorSQL.

Create a JDBC Data Source for Hugging Face Data

  1. Open the RazorSQL application and, in the Connections menu, select Add Connection Profile -> Other -> JDBC.
  2. In the Connection Wizard that appears, set the following properties:
    • Driver Location: Set this property to the path to the lib subfolder in the installation directory.
    • Driver Class: Set the driver class to cdata.jdbc.api.APIDriver.
    • Username: Enter the username. (This property can also be set in the JDBC URL.)
    • Password: Enter the password. (This property can also be set in the JDBC URL.)
    • JDBC URL: Enter connection parameters. The JDBC URL begins with jdbc:api: and is followed by a semicolon-separated list of connection properties.

      HuggingFace Hub uses token-based authentication to enable access to its API. The API provides access to machine learning models, datasets, spaces, papers, and other resources on the HuggingFace Hub platform.

      Using API Key Authentication

      To authenticate to HuggingFace Hub, you will need to provide an API Key (Access Token). To obtain your access token:

      1. Log in to your HuggingFace account at https://huggingface.co
      2. Navigate to Settings > Access Tokens
      3. Click "New token" to create a new access token
      4. Select the appropriate permissions (read or write)
      5. Copy the token value

      After obtaining your access token, set the following connection properties:

      • AuthScheme: Set this to APIKey.
      • APIKey: Set this to your HuggingFace access token.

      Example connection string

      Profile=C:\profiles\HuggingFace.apip;ProfileSettings='APIKey=hf_x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x';
      

      Built-in Connection String Designer

      For assistance in constructing the JDBC URL, use the connection string designer built into the Hugging Face JDBC Driver. Either double-click the JAR file or execute the jar file from the command-line.

      java -jar cdata.jdbc.api.jar
      

      Fill in the connection properties and copy the connection string to the clipboard.

      A typical JDBC URL is the following:

      jdbc:api:Profile=C:\profiles\HuggingFace.apip;ProfileSettings='APIKey=hf_x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x';

Query Hugging Face Data and Select Tables

After establishing a connection, the wizard will close and the connection will be available in the connections panel. You can then query the tables.
